From simple calculators to basic games, projects bridged the abstract and the playful. A tic-tac-toe program taught strategy; a file I/O assignment taught persistence. These small triumphs turned the classroom into a studio: a place where ideas are prototyped, broken, and rebuilt. The pride of seeing code run without errors is quiet but deep.
Often the shortest unit, but crucial. It introduces problem-solving approaches: algorithms, flowcharts, pseudocode, and the vital concepts of modular programming and top-down design . Arora’s hallmark here is the "dry run" tables, which force students to manually trace code logic before typing it.
The interplay between the Central Processing Unit (CPU), memory hierarchies, and input/output devices.
His teacher had given the class a challenge: write a Python program that could predict the next day's weather using basic and Loops . While his classmates were stuck on syntax errors, Aarav was treating the textbook like a sorcerer's grimoire. He realized that the Computational Thinking chapter wasn't just about math—it was about breaking a massive problem into tiny, manageable "bricks." computer science sumita arora class 11 2021
| Title | Key Focus & Features | Page Count | Target Board | | :--- | :--- | :--- | :--- | | | Core Python textbook for general CBSE students. Detailed coverage of the entire syllabus with numerous examples and exercises. | 715 pages | CBSE (Subject Code 083) | | Computer Science With Python Textbook For Class-11 (2020-2021) | Similar to the above, but specifically labeled for the 2020-2021 examination session. | 690 pages | CBSE | | Cbse Computer Science With Python Class - Xi | A comprehensive textbook, likely a later reprint or a special edition, with a slightly higher page count. | 720 pages | CBSE | | A Textbook of Computer Science with Java for Class 11 (2021-2022) | Focuses on Java programming language instead of Python. Includes detailed explanations and exam-style questions. | Information not available | ISC (Class 11) |
This article provides an in-depth look at this popular textbook, its features, and why it is indispensable for Class 11 students. 1. Overview of the Textbook
Mastering Class 11 Computer Science: A Guide to the Sumita Arora Curriculum From simple calculators to basic games, projects bridged
Unit 2 (Computational Thinking and Programming) carries the maximum weightage (roughly 45 marks), followed by Unit 1 (10 marks) and Unit 3 (15 marks).
The 2021 edition is meticulously designed to prepare students for the specific rigors of the board exam. It categorizes questions into "Very Short Answer," "Short Answer," and "Long Answer" types. This classification trains the student in time management and answer structuring.
Sumita Arora begins by demystifying the physical layer of computing. Instead of jumping straight into code, students learn how a central processing unit executes low-level computational cycles. The pride of seeing code run without errors
This is the core of the textbook, introducing students to the world of Python programming. The book meticulously covers:
Here are the key features of the . This book is widely prescribed by the CBSE (Central Board of Secondary Education) and is known for its student-friendly approach.
Often overlooked, this unit covers the "soft" side of tech—cyber safety, digital footprints, and the environmental impact of e-waste. Sumita Arora’s book provides concise notes here that are perfect for scoring easy marks in the theory paper. Top Study Tips for the 2021 Edition
For the aspiring hacker or the naturally curious student, the book can sometimes feel too academic. It prioritizes the "how" and the "what" over the creative "why." The examples are often mathematical or academic in nature (calculating grades, finding prime numbers). To truly fall in love with programming, a student often needs to look beyond this book—to projects involving game development, web scraping, or data analysis—to see the vibrant possibilities that the Python syntax unlocks.